Liposuction Surgery Payment Options
When laser liposuction became an FDA approved cosmetic surgery procedure, it made small treatments more affordable and available to many people. Still, the costs of any surgery is expensive and some people who may be candidates never take the first step because they don’t think they could afford such an expensive procedure.
Had they gone in for consultation, they would have found that on top of being a candidate for laser liposuction they also could qualify for financing. Many surgeons will work out a payment plan that can suit almost any budget. In fact, there is more than one option when it comes to paying for liposuction surgery.
Because of the potential patient’s price sensitivity, many people make the mistake of shopping for cosmetic surgery based on price instead of surgeon credentials. This is a recipe for potential disaster. Don’t choose your surgeon based on the price. Choosing a poorly qualified surgeon could jeopardize your health in a major way.
To begin with, most clinics will tell you that they accept a range of payment types. From the basics such as checks, credit card, and cash to all variations of financing strategies. Some places will even carry the financing in-house so you can get a tailored payment plan specifically for your situation.
Talk to a surgeon in your area to see what financing options are available. Some surgeons will work with local companies to help patients financing for their treatment. They can help break the costs of your liposuction costs into affordable monthly payments.
